Yogyakarta, along with Mount Bromo, were tourist spots in Java Island, Indonesia that I was most excited to visit. I wanted to see Borobudur and Prambanan since I consider them among the most visually impressive temple complexes in all of South East Asia.

Borobudur was widely known as the single biggest Buddhist temple structure in the world. Meanwhile, Prambanan was the largest Hindu temple in Indonesia.

I also didn’t want to miss out on exploring Yogyakarta city center, especially after reading travel blog entries about its water castle and underground mosque.

Itinerary Overview

Day 1Yogyakarta City Center

Jakarta to Yogyakarta Flight

Yogyakarta Hostel

Day 2Yogyakarta City Center

Yogyakarta Walking Tour

Day 3Prambanan

Prambanan Temple

Day 4Borobodur

Borobodur Temple

Yogyakarta to Bromo via Malang and Ngadas

Trip date: March 2012

Route Map

Itinerary Notes & Tips

Day 1

Jakarta to Yogyakarta Flight

  • Arrival at Yogyakarta Airport
  • Eat at Singgalang Jaya, Yogyakarta Airport – Rp21,000
    • Daging Rendang – Rp15,000
    • Nasih Putih (rice) – Rp6,000
  • Ride bus from Yogyakarta Airport to City Center

Yogyakarta Hostel Search

  • Walk to Sosrowijayan St. (Jalan Sosrowijayan)
  • Check-in at Bu Purwo Losmen (Sosrowijayan Wetan GT. 1/100; (0274) 589764)
    • Double fan room (queen-sized bed; shared TB) – Rp80,000
    • Decent place to stay filled with colorful paintings.
  • Laundry done at Mama Seng’s Batik Shop (near Bu Purwo Losmen) – Rp10,000 per kilo
  • Market run
    • Bottled H20 (1.5L) – Rp4,000
    • Nissin Butter Coconut Biscuits (small) – Rp3,500
  • Dinner at Jogja Kopitiam (Jalan Sosrowijayan; Free WiFi) – Rp29,000
    • Lumpia Ayam – Rp12,000
    • Mie Goreng Seafood – Rp17,000
    • Liked eating here mostly for the WiFi but the food and prices were pretty decent as well.

Day 2

  • Buy at batik shop
    • Purple scarf – Rp40,000
  • 11:25am – Check-out at Bu Purwo Losmen
  • 11:30am – Check-in at Losmen Anda
    • Single fan room (private TB) – Rp70,000rp (Rp35,000 per night x 2 nights)
    • One of the cheapest (bang for your buck) places to stay in Yogyakarta. The family running Losmen Anda gave a very warm reception.
  • Lunch @Bedhot Resto – Rp25,000
    • Rendang Padang (West Sumatran food)
    • Java Coffee
    • Bottled Water
    • Loved eating here for the delicious food and coffee

Yogyakarta City Center Walking Tour

  • Walk to Water Castle (Taman Sari)
    • The underground mosque was very hard to find. It was an interesting spot to visit and photograph when in the area.
    • A few people would come up to me for a chat, would start guiding me around, and later lead me to a souvenir shop. Best to ignore these people. The old man who befriended me told me the underground mosque was closed before he got rid me. I did not trust him, so I went inside the old city ruins again (using another gate) and discovered the underground mosque on my own … it was still open.
  • Dinner at Soto Ayam restaurant (Malioboro St.)
    • Soto Ayam (noodles) – 8,000rp
    • Iced Tea – 3,000rp
  • Shopping @Yogyakarta Malioboro Mall
  • 2nd dinner at @Zon’s sidestreet stall near the entrance of Jalan Dagen
    • Satay Padang (7 sticks) + 2 rice – Rp12,000
  • 9:24pm – Market run @Indomarket
    • Bottled water 550ml – Rp2,300
    • Minute main Tropical flavor – Rp6,900
    • Lux Beauty Soap – Rp2,750
    • Laundry powder x 2 – Rp1,400
    • Nabati cheese wafer x 3 – Rp4,200
  • 3rd dinner and WIFI at Cecko – Rp17,000

Day 3

Buy Yogyakarta to Malang Train Ticket

  • Walk to Tugu Train Station
  • 10:25am – Fill up card and get priority number from the guard. My priority number was #238 and the counter was serving #150 when I got there.
  • Buy Nescafe Iced Coffee @Indomaret – 7,500rm
  • 11:30am – Buy overnight train from Yogyakarta to Malang via Malabar Express – Rp160,000
    • Yogyakarta departure: 11:38pm
    • Malang arrival: 07:04am
    • Seat Class: Business Class
    • Cheapest seat
      • Economy class – Rp110,000
  • Lunch @sidestreet stall near Hostel Anda
    • Gado-gado (vegetable salad with peanut sauce) – Rp7,000
    • Coffee – Rp3,000

Prambanan Temple Complex Walking Tour

  • Walk to Malioboro St. bus stop
  • Ride Transjogja Bus “1A” to Prambanan – Rp3,000
  • Prambanan Temple Complex Walking Tour
    • Entrance fee – USD18 (foreign adult)
  • Dinner at Superman Resto – Rp28,500
    • Nasi Goreng with Satay + Iced Tea

Day 4

Borobudur Temple Complex Walking Tour

  • 5:15am – wake up and then find ojek driver
  • Ride ojek from Yogyakarta City Center to Borobudur
    • Beautiful sunrise along the main highway
  • 6:30am – Borobudur arrival
    • Entrance fee – USD20 (foreign adult)
  • Buy Telkomsel (Indonesian mobile network) sim card – Rp19,000
    • +prepaid load – Rp5,000
  • Borobudur entrance ticket (for foreign tourists) – US$15
  • Borobudur Temple Walking Tour
  • Ride ojek from Borobudur to Yogyakarta City Center via countryside back roads

Yogyakarta to Mount Bromo

  • Dinner @Bedhot Resto
    • Nasi Goreng ala Bedhot (Fried rice with Shrimp and Chicken Satay) – Rp25,000
    • Black Coffee – Rp5,000
  • 11:00pm – Hostel Anda checkout